What you’ll be doing

  • Provide expert 1st line support to our clients while maintaining the organisation’s standards of technical proficiency and customer service.
  • Offer thorough IT assistance for technical matters related to Microsoft core business applications and operating systems.
  • Work towards, and help drive, both your own and the team’s objectives and KPI targets, contributing to our shared success.
  • Keep precise system and client records, consistently ensuring service quality and compliance. Record all work in the helpdesk for transparency and business continuity.
  • Demonstrate excellent teamwork and clear, proactive communication both internally and with our clients to ensure seamless service delivery.
  • Carry out installation tasks, including setting up PCs, routers, printers, and AV equipment, ensuring every deployment aligns with our best practice standards for reliability and efficiency.
  • Communicate effectively with clients, keeping them informed of support ticket progress, upcoming changes, or planned service outages.
  • Collaborate closely with colleagues to maintain open lines of communication and a unified approach to problem-solving within Select Technology.
  • Escalate service requests that require engineer-level expertise, ensuring timely and effective resolution in line with our escalation processes.
  • Demonstrate a clear understanding of, and adherence to established service processes, ensuring every action meets our operational standards.
  • Keep customer satisfaction and operational effectiveness at the heart of everything you do.

What will you bring to the table?

  • Proven 1st line IT support experience: Demonstrable background in providing desktop, networking, and infrastructure support within fast-moving business environments.
  • Team player: A collaborative mindset, always ready to assist colleagues and foster a positive team culture.
  • Stay ahead of the curve with industry best practices and emerging technologies.
  • Support, configure, and troubleshoot Microsoft technologies (Windows OS, Microsoft 365 Cloud, Office Applications).
  • Basic network fundamentals knowledge including LAN, DNS & DHCP.
  • Proven system administration tasks and user access management (Active Directory, Azure Active Directory, Microsoft 365).
  • Provide installation and support for hardware, end-user devices, and peripherals.
  • Relevant qualifications: Training and certifications in Microsoft 365, Networking, are advantageous but not mandatory. Above all, a strong desire to learn and develop professionally is essential.
  • Outstanding interpersonal skills: Clear and confident communication over the phone, effective listening, and a commitment to delivering excellent customer service.
  • Technical troubleshooting ability: A proven talent for resolving technical issues efficiently, supporting both clients and team members.
  • Proactive and self-motivated: Capable of working independently, thriving in a dynamic environment, and taking initiative to overcome daily challenges.
  • Passionate about technology and service excellence: A genuine enthusiasm for technology and an unwavering dedication to meeting customer needs and delivering high-quality service.
